Latest Patents

Kuiper's latest patents showcase his innovative approach to data storage and magnetic structures. One notable patent is the "Multi-stack optical data storage medium and use of such medium." This invention describes a sophisticated multi-stack optical data storage medium that allows for rewritable recording using a focused radiation beam. The design involves a substrate on which a first recording stack with a phase-change type recording layer is deposited, located at the furthest position from the entrance face. Notably, further recording stacks are placed closer to the entrance, each containing a metal reflective layer of copper, which enhances optical transmission and thermal management while exhibiting low chemical reactivity.

Another noteworthy patent is the "Method of manufacturing a spin valve structure." This patent details a process for creating a Giant Magnetoresistance (GMR) type spin valve structure by carefully controlling the oxidation of ferromagnetic materials and the deposition of aluminum. This method ensures the achievement of a highly effective GMR effect, thus pushing the boundaries of magnetic sensor technology.
